Speed Engineering and Hosting
Optimizing server response and using a CDN cuts unnecessary server strain from crawlers and users. Techniques include reducing TTFB, enabling Brotli compression, and configuring cache-control headers so crawlers avoid refetching unchanged assets.
What Is Intent-Driven Keyword Research?
Intent-driven keyword research means grouping queries by commercial, transactional, and informational intent to prioritize keywords that signal purchase readiness. This gives a direct line to prospects who are evaluating solutions, pricing, or vendors.

What is crawl budget and why should I care? Crawl budget is the number of URLs a search engine bot will fetch from your site in a given time window. It matters because inefficient crawling can delay indexing of important pages and consume server resources, especially on large or dynamically generated sites.
How to Use/Apply/Implement 6 Technical SEO Fixes That Improve Crawl Efficiency
Implementation starts with measurement: capture server logs, run a site crawl, and benchmark server response metrics to create an evidence-based plan. Tools such as Loggly, Splunk, Screaming Frog, Botify, and Google Search Console are essential for the audit and ongoing monitoring.
